If she had the time, I think she would've done more full tracks, but it's rather obvious that after (miss)understood, all the albums have been made in a really quick manner [not a lazy one.] Say someone gave you 12 hours or less to create an piece of art [music, a dress, something creative.] and you wanted to do something big. You would not be able to execute it perfectly compared to if you had 24 hours or more... if you get what I'm saying, you should understand that laziness is not the same thing as trying to get something done quickly when you have time constraints. I'm not sure if this makes sense, but basically, Ayu could've done more, but there's a pretty strict schedule. See reality shows that involve creative spirits like Top Chef / Project Runway for things like this, except apply that concept to an album and increase the amount of time. I would say that Rock'n'Roll Circus is the first time in a while where she hasn't really abided by a super strict deadline and is instead finishing things as she pleases. It's a good thing though. (Spending 3+ months instead of 2 or waaaaay less.) I'm sorry that you think Ayu is being lazy by constantly working for the past 3 months, but I feel that she is working her BUTT off and even though the previous albums had 4 interludes, she was STILL working her tail off given the amount of time she had to complete the albums. Secret had only 3 or so weeks to complete another half of the album, GUILTY was done after some sort of "writer's block" or something with Ayu finished 5 songs' lyrics in one day, and NEXT LEVEL was done in a pretty quick manner between Days/GREEN -> mid-February for about 2 months. It really pains me to see when people say Ayu is being lazy when she's practically working nearly ALL YEAR. -crazyface- Schedules for end of 2008-2010: 10~11/2008 - Work on COUNTDOWN LIVE, record new singles 12/2008 - release and promote new single, perform at COUNTDOWN LIVE, announce tour 01/2009 - Work on ARENA TOUR, work on new single/album 02/2009 - release Rule/Sparkle, promote minimally while also working on ARENA TOUR, work on new album 03/2009 - release NEXT LEVEL at end of month, also promoting and working on ARENA TOUR 04~07/2009 - ARENA TOUR begins and runs for a few months, work on new single for August 08~09/2009 - release Sunrise/Sunset and promote, do a-nation '09, corrections for ARENA TOUR 10/2009 - ARENA TOUR finale, and work on new single, come up with concepts for COUNTDOWN LIVE 11~12/2009 - work on new single, work on COUNTDOWN LIVE, perform at COUNTDOWN LIVE, release new single, promote new single as well 01/2010 - Work on ARENA TOUR, work on new album 02/2010 - Work on ARENA TOUR, work on new album 03/2010 - Work on ARENA TOUR, work on new album 04~-07/2010 - ARENA TOUR begins, Rock'n'Roll Circus releases and promotion [?]08~09/2010 - a-nation '10[?], along with new single? [?]10~11/2010 - new single release[?]... planning for COUNTDOWN LIVE.. etc...
